Toy drive on December 12, 2021, to celebrate memory of Jackson girl, Jocelyn Hampel | By Officer Jennifer Gerke

Jackson, WI – Many of you have heard about Jocelyn Hampel’s story – the sweet little girl that passed away in January after complications during a dental procedure.

Jocelyn has been part of the Jackson Police Department (JPD) Facebook family for a while now. A picture of her and her sister Tenley is one of our most “liked” photos ever on Facebook.
Back in July 2019, we posted the pic of Officer Henning with the girls. Officer Henning responded to their house for a rescue call for their little brother. Grandma was on her way to watch the girls because Mom had gone to the hospital with him. Officer Henning volunteered to hang out with the girls until Grandma could get there. The girls had so much fun throwing a stuffed alligator across the living room with Officer Henning (see photo above). Their laughter was contagious.
The next picture is of Jocelyn, Tenley, and their Dad after they built a snowman for our First Annual Snowman Competition.
Unfortunately, Jocelyn passed away before being able to make her snowman last winter.
Christmas was Jocelyn’s favorite time of the year and her birthday is in December. She loved all the lights and decorations. Her family is using the holiday to give back amid their grief, collecting toys for kids at Children’s Hospital.
There are several ways that you can help celebrate Jocelyn’s memory and help the kids at Children’s:
You can celebrate Jocelyn’s birthday on December 12, 2021, from 12 p.m. to 3 p.m. by bringing toy donations to W202N17298 Oakwood Dr, Jackson, WI. The family will be hosting a drive-thru toy donation event.
